Author:  CRD Joe [ Fri May 22, 2009 6:08 pm ]
Post subject: 

Normal samurai's had a 79.9" wheelbase. The long wheelbase jobs had a 94" wheelbase like a jeep wrangler. Mine has been stretched to 100".

THanks everyone. Its to bad they never brought them to the United States. I mean look at all that bed space.
